II. The Conversion Factor: Centimeters to Inches

The fundamental conversion factor between centimeters and inches is crucial for accurate conversion. One inch is precisely defined as 2.54 centimeters. This means that 1 in = 2.54 cm, and conversely, 1 cm ≈ 0.3937 in. This precise value allows for accurate conversions between the two systems. The approximation (≈) is used for the inverse conversion because the decimal representation of 1/2.54 is an infinitely repeating decimal.

III. Methods for Converting 132 cm to Inches

There are several ways to convert 132 cm to inches. Let's explore two common methods:

A. Direct Conversion using the Conversion Factor:

The most straightforward method involves directly applying the conversion factor. Since 1 in = 2.54 cm, we can set up a proportion:

1 in / 2.54 cm = x in / 132 cm

To solve for 'x' (the number of inches), we cross-multiply and divide:

x in = (132 cm 1 in) / 2.54 cm

x in ≈ 51.97 in

Therefore, 132 cm is approximately equal to 51.97 inches.

B. Conversion using Unit Cancellation (Dimensional Analysis):

This method utilizes unit cancellation to ensure the correct units are obtained. It involves multiplying the given value by a conversion factor that cancels out the original unit (cm) and leaves the desired unit (in).

132 cm (1 in / 2.54 cm) = 51.97 in

Notice how the "cm" units cancel out, leaving only "in". This method ensures the calculation is dimensionally correct.


IV. Understanding Significant Figures and Rounding

The accuracy of the conversion depends on the number of significant figures used. In our example, 132 cm has three significant figures. The conversion factor (2.54 cm/in) is considered exact and has an infinite number of significant figures. Therefore, the result should also be expressed to three significant figures, which is why we round 51.9685 to 51.97 in. Understanding significant figures is vital for presenting results with appropriate accuracy in scientific and engineering applications.

VI. Addressing Potential Errors in Conversion

Common errors in unit conversion include:

Incorrect conversion factor: Using an incorrect conversion factor leads to significant errors. Always double-check the correct factor (1 in = 2.54 cm).
Incorrect unit cancellation: Failing to cancel units properly can lead to incorrect units in the final answer.
Rounding errors: Improper rounding can introduce errors, especially in calculations involving multiple steps. Always follow the rules of significant figures.
